Understanding Different Kinds Of Medical Facility Beds
When you're choosing a healthcare facility bed, it's essential to recognize the different types offered to meet particular client needs. Conventional healthcare facility beds are adjustable, enabling for changes in height and setting, which can enhance convenience and access. If flexibility is a problem, take into consideration a low-bed version that lessens fall risk by decreasing the framework close to the ground.
For clients requiring even more specific treatment, consider bariatric beds, made to sustain much heavier weights, or electric health center beds, which supply easy adjustments with the press of a button. Some beds come with integrated features like side rails or integrated ranges, offering added security and ease.
If you're looking for something a lot more functional, consider a multifunctional bed that suits various positions and functions. Recognizing these choices will certainly equip you to pick a healthcare facility bed tailored to the distinct demands of the client, guaranteeing their convenience and security throughout recovery.

Weight Capability Considerations
Selecting a medical facility bed also involves considering its weight capacity, which is necessary for making sure security and comfort. You need to analyze the individual's weight and any potential future adjustments. A lot of hospital beds have weight abilities ranging from 250 to 600 pounds, so it's crucial to select one that can suit the specific comfortably without taking the chance of architectural integrity. If you're not sure, look for beds with greater weight restrictions, as they commonly supply included resilience. In addition, think about the bed's framework materials; steel structures normally supply far better support than light weight aluminum ones. Always seek advice from medical care experts to determine the most effective option based on particular requirements. Correct weight capacity not just boosts comfort yet also minimizes the threat of accidents or bed failures.

Manual vs. Electric Healthcare facility Beds
When it pertains to selecting healthcare facility beds, understanding the differences between handbook and electrical choices is vital for making sure convenience and capability. Hand-operated medical facility beds require you to readjust the placement using a hand crank, which can be straightforward yet may be literally requiring for caretakers. If you need a bed that's simple to run without much effort, an electrical hospital bed might be the better choice.
Electric beds give flexible positions at the touch of a button, making it simpler for both caregivers and patients. They're especially beneficial for people with limited wheelchair or specific medical needs, as they enable quick changes to boost comfort.
Eventually, your option must depend on the client's problem, the caretaker's capabilities, and budget restrictions. Both options have their merits, so weigh the pros and cons meticulously to find what best meets your requirements.

Upkeep and Longevity of Hospital Beds
Since health center beds are a significant financial investment, understanding their upkeep and resilience is necessary for assuring long-term value. Normal maintenance can prolong the life of your bed and improve its functionality. Begin by routinely looking for loosened screws, worn-out parts, or any type of signs of deterioration. Cleansing is equally essential; usage mild, non-abrasive services to prevent harming the surface.
When it comes to sturdiness, look for beds made from high-quality materials and durable structures. Steel building and constructions frequently supply far better longevity compared to lightweight options. Additionally, take into consideration beds with warranties that cover parts and labor; this can conserve you money on fixings down the line.
Don't fail to remember to inform personnel or caregivers on appropriate usage and dealing with to stop unneeded damage. By prioritizing maintenance and choosing durable beds, you'll guarantee a reliable and safe environment for clients over time.
